引言
随着科技的发展,虚拟现实(VR)和增强现实(AR)技术已经逐渐渗透到我们的日常生活中。其中,混合现实(MR)技术作为一种结合了VR和AR优势的新型技术,正在为家居设计领域带来前所未有的变革。本文将探讨MR虚拟现实软件在家居设计中的应用,以及它如何帮助我们预见未来家的样子。
MR虚拟现实软件概述
什么是MR?
混合现实(MR)是一种将虚拟信息与真实世界融合的技术。它结合了VR的沉浸感和AR的互动性,用户可以通过MR设备同时感知到虚拟世界和现实世界的存在。
MR虚拟现实软件的特点
- 沉浸式体验:MR技术可以创建一个虚拟的环境,让用户仿佛置身其中,感受不同的家居风格和布局。
- 互动性:用户可以通过MR设备与虚拟家居进行交互,例如移动家具、改变颜色等。
- 实时反馈:MR软件可以实时显示家居设计方案的效果,帮助用户做出更明智的决策。
MR虚拟现实软件在家居设计中的应用
1. 前期规划
在开始实际装修之前,使用MR虚拟现实软件可以预览不同家居风格和布局,帮助设计师和用户确定设计方向。
**示例代码**:
```javascript
// 假设有一个MR软件的API,用于创建一个虚拟房间
function createVirtualRoom(style, layout) {
// 根据传入的风格和布局参数,创建虚拟房间
// ...
}
// 用户选择家居风格和布局
createVirtualRoom('现代简约', '开放式');
2. 家具摆放
MR软件可以帮助用户在虚拟环境中尝试不同的家具摆放方式,找到最合适的布局。
**示例代码**:
```javascript
// 假设有一个函数,用于在虚拟房间中摆放家具
function placeFurniture(room, furniture, position) {
// 将家具放置到指定位置
// ...
}
// 用户尝试不同的家具摆放
placeFurniture(virtualRoom, '沙发', '客厅角落');
3. 颜色搭配
通过MR软件,用户可以轻松尝试不同的颜色搭配,找到最满意的家居色调。
**示例代码**:
```javascript
// 假设有一个函数,用于改变房间的颜色
function changeRoomColor(room, color) {
// 改变房间颜色
// ...
}
// 用户尝试不同的颜色搭配
changeRoomColor(virtualRoom, '#FF5733');
4. 实时调整
MR软件允许用户在虚拟环境中实时调整家居设计,直到满意为止。
**示例代码**:
```javascript
// 假设有一个函数,用于实时调整家居设计
function adjustDesign(room, changes) {
// 根据用户输入的调整,实时更新虚拟房间
// ...
}
// 用户调整家居设计
adjustDesign(virtualRoom, { 'windowSize': 'larger', 'wallColor': '#FFFFFF' });
预见未来家
随着MR虚拟现实技术的不断发展,我们可以预见未来家将具有以下特点:
- 个性化:每个家庭都可以根据自己的需求和喜好定制家居设计。
- 智能化:家居设备将更加智能化,能够根据用户的需求自动调整。
- 环保节能:家居设计将更加注重环保和节能。
结论
MR虚拟现实软件为家居设计领域带来了巨大的变革,它不仅提高了设计效率和用户体验,还为预见未来家提供了新的可能性。随着技术的不断进步,我们有理由相信,未来的家居生活将更加美好。
